WebThe octahedral SbF6 is formed when HF releases its proton (H+) and its conjugate base (F) is sequestered by one or more molecules of SbF5. This anion is classified as noncoordinating because it is both a very weak nucleophile and a very weak base. The proton effectively becomes “naked,” explaining the system’s high acidity.
